For years, American politicians have failed to take climate change seriously. The 2016 presidential debates didn’t even include a single climate question. Fast-forward four years, and climate change is a major election issue. So how did 2020 become a climate election? This week, how a bunch of outsiders turned the Green New Deal into a national rallying cry — and pushed Joe Biden to adopt the most ambitious climate platform in U.S. history.
